Transaction 43f2977fc5979b47ccddfda843b1732ab1603e3ed3d02c05ae1e55df7400a3e7
2 Input
2 Outputs
- 43f2977fc5979b47ccddfda843b1732ab1603e3ed3d02c05ae1e55df7400a3e7:0
- 43f2977fc5979b47ccddfda843b1732ab1603e3ed3d02c05ae1e55df7400a3e7:1
value 316282
address 1CWPQZSfbw7568utkmdLSnM4p9crmXYR7N
value 257600
address 14u38FYyfKcoanc8Qz3KdrAcHMprWivAvS